Behavioral Expectations for Google Meet

  • Adhere to HCPSS Policy 8080 Responsible Use of Technology and Social Media and other relevant HCPSS policies.
  • Follow the school’s values P.R.I.D.E
  • Students will only be permitted into a Google Meet session with a HCPSS email account.  All students can be identified through their HCPSS email account.
  • Inappropriate/offensive/threatening comments, misrepresentation of identity, and/or disruptive participants (invited or uninvited) during Google Meet sessions will not be tolerated.
  • Sharing login information violates the confidentiality rights of other students and places them at risk of having to witness disruptive behaviors from students who are not members of the class or school community.
  • Students who are disruptive and/or “trespass” Google Meet sessions will be immediately reported to administration and will receive appropriate consequences in accordance with the HCPSS Code of Conduct.  Consequences may result in temporary or permanent loss of technology access, which will also result in a student's inability to participate in Google Meet sessions; arrangement for receiving instruction and assignments will be established by administration communicated and arranged with parents.

Google Icon

Glenelg High School accepts as an educational task the responsibility of assisting students in developing a safe and healthy learning environment, even in the virtual classroom. Google icons considered to be disruptive, provocative, and/or dangerous or offensive, or interferes with learning may not be displayed. We encourage students to use an icon that is a photo of themselves or the icon provided by Google.

Icons that advertise any illegal substances, including alcohol and tobacco, profanity, weapons violence, or nudity may not be used. If a student has an icon with any of these items, he/she will be asked to change it immediately. 

Students in violation of this will be asked to change the icon into something appropriate for school.
